Job Overview

The Supply Tech Associate learns and trains in the field of supply inventory at Children's Hospital Colorado. This position assists with supply chain activities related to product receipt, distribution and replenishment, and supporting department goals across the organization. Facilitate the receipt and placement of inbound medical supplies and other delivered product, both physically and in CHCO's ERP system.

Duties & Responsibilities

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
An employee in this position may be called upon to do any or all of the following essential functions. These examples do not include all of the functions which the employee may be expected to perform.

  • 1. Maintains a clean and organized work environment.
    2. Trains to safely operate all equipment needed to perform job tasks including but not limited to handhelds, pallet jacks, carts, and carousels.
    3. Trains to become proficient in receiving product upon arrival, confirms quantity, inspects, and ability to sort and put away or deliver product when necessary as defined by departments standard processes.
    4. Assists with perform cycle counts and follow outdate procedures for all storage locations both departmentally and managed system PAR locations.
    5. Supports Supply Chain Management to ensure existing inventory satisfy targets as established by department leadership.
    6. Learns how to monitor excess, check expiration dates and waste within supply rooms and managed PAR locations.
    7. Assists with receiving vendor deliveries and manage outbound shipments of any product exiting the hospital.
    8. Assists with providing customer service to all clinical, business and support staff.

SCOPE AND LEVEL
Guidelines: Trains in the field and assists higher level personnel to acquire learning through practical experience.
Complexity: Performs routine and/or basic tasks common to the field. Procedures, methods, and techniques to be used are well established with options to be considered well defined. Tools, work aids, and materials to be used are specified.
Decision Making: Duties assigned are primarily routine, repetitive, and restricted in intricacy with little or no discretion in how they are carried out.
Communications: Contacts with team members, clients or the public where factual information relative to the organization or its functions are received, relayed, or a service rendered according to established procedures or instructions.
Supervision Received: Under close supervision, the employee receives training to develop skills and abilities in a specific line of work or general occupational area. Work product is subject to close, continuous inspection.
